What You Need for Black Bean Avocado Chocolate Chip Fudge Brownies

Black Bean Avocado Chocolate Chip Fudge Brownies

When it comes to creating irresistible desserts, the ingredients are key, and these brownies are no exception. The philosophy behind the selection of ingredients is to combine wholesome elements that enhance flavor and texture while keeping things nutritious. The star players in this recipe are black beans, which serve as a fantastic base, and avocado, which adds creaminess and healthy fats. Together, they create a delightful balance that makes for a truly memorable treat.

  • 1 – 15oz can of black beans, rinsed and drained: The foundation of these brownies, black beans add moisture and protein without the need for traditional flour.
  • 1 egg: This helps bind the ingredients together, giving the brownies a rich texture.
  • 2 egg whites: Adding egg whites helps lighten the texture while keeping the brownies fudgy.
  • 1/2 of a large extra ripe avocado: This creamy ingredient adds healthy fats and enhances the chewy texture.
  • 1 teaspoon coconut oil: Adds richness and a hint of tropical flavor.
  • 2/3 cup unsweetened cocoa powder: A must for that deep chocolate flavor, using high-quality cocoa powder is essential for the best results.
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der: Helps the brownies rise slightly.
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king soda: Works alongside the baking powder for a light texture.
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t: Balances the sweetness and enhances the chocolate flavor.
  • 2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ract: Adds a lovely aroma and flavor depth.
  • 2/3 cup brown sugar: Provides sweetness and moisture to the brownies.
  • 1/3 cup chocolate chips of choice, plus 2 tablespoons for topping: For added chocolatey goodness and a delightful texture. Use your favorite variety!

Black Bean Avocado Chocolate Chip Fudge Brownies Instructions

Black Bean Avocado Chocolate Chip Fudge Brownies

Making Black Bean Avocado Chocolate Chip Fudge Brownies is as easy as it is rewarding. You’ll be amazed at how quickly everything comes together, and soon enough, you’ll be enjoying these delicious treats. Just follow these simple steps and get ready to indulge!

  1. Preheat your oven to 350 degrees F. This initial step is crucial for creating that perfect brownie texture. A well-heated oven ensures even baking.
  2. Grease an 8×8 inch baking pan with cooking spray or coconut oil. This prevents sticking and helps achieve those clean edges we all love in a brownie.
  3. In a blender or food processor, place all ingredients except for the chocolate chips. Start blending or processing until the mixture forms a smooth batter. You want it to be thick but not too dense.
  4. If you find that the batter is too thick to blend, don’t worry! Add in one or two teaspoons of water to loosen it up. The goal is a batter that is thick enough for fudgy brownies.
  5. Once your batter is smooth, fold in 1/3 cup of chocolate chips. This adds delightful bursts of chocolate throughout the brownies.
  6. Pour the batter into your prepared baking pan. Use a spatula to spread it out evenly.
  7. Sprinkle the remaining 2 tablespoons of chocolate chips on top of the batter for an extra chocolaty finish. You could also mix in some nuts or swirl in nut butter if you’re feeling adventurous!
  8. Place the pan in the oven and bake for 25 to 35 minutes. Keep an eye on them; you want a knife inserted in the center to come out somewhat clean, and the top should begin to crack.
  9. Once baked, remove the pan from the oven and let it cool completely on a wire rack. This cooling time helps the brownies set properly.
  10. After they’ve cooled, cut into 12 squares. Enjoy your delicious homemade Black Bean Avocado Chocolate Chip Fudge Brownies!

Things Worth Knowing

  • Choose ripe avocados: Ensure your avocado is perfectly ripe for the best texture. It should feel slightly soft when gently squeezed.
  • Don’t overmix: Once you add the chocolate chips, fold them in gently to avoid overworking the batter.
  • Cool completely: Allowing the brownies to cool completely enhances their fudge-like texture and makes cutting easier.
  • Experiment with flavors: Feel free to add spices like cinnamon or a pinch of cayenne for a unique twist!
  • Check for doneness: Each oven is different, so always check your brownies a few minutes early to avoid overbaking.

FAQ

Absolutely! To make Black Bean Avocado Chocolate Chip Fudge Brownies vegan, simply replace the egg with a flax egg. This can be made by mixing one tablespoon of ground flaxseed with three tablespoons of water. Allow it to sit for about five minutes until it thickens. Additionally, use vegan chocolate chips to keep the recipe entirely plant-based. You’ll still achieve a deliciously fudgy texture without compromising on flavor!

Leftover Black Bean Avocado Chocolate Chip Fudge Brownies should be stored in an airtight container. They can be kept at room temperature for up to three days, but if you want to keep them fresh for longer, refrigerating them is a great option. Just remember to let them come to room temperature again before serving. You can also freeze them by wrapping them individually or in a batch, which keeps them tasty for up to three months!
